contents Using the hybrid formalism with manifest $N=1$ $d=4$ spacetime supersymmetry, we construct the quadratic term in the heterotic superstring field theory action. As in open superstring field theory using the hybrid formalism, the heterotic string field theory action is constructed with three string fields and the massless sector describes $N=1$ $d=10$ supergravity in terms of $N=1$ $d=4$ superfields.
